Bridging the Gap: From Data to Insight with Edge AI

The proliferation of data across industries has created a pressing need for real-time processing. Traditional cloud-based approaches often fall short in meeting these demands due to latency issues and bandwidth constraints. This is where Edge AI emerges as a transformative solution, bringing computation directly to the data source. By deploying AI models at the edge, Edge AI enables instantaneous insights and decision-making, unlocking new possibilities in areas such including autonomous vehicles, industrial automation, and smart systems.

The benefits for Edge AI are manifold. Firstly, it significantly reduces latency by processing data at its origin, eliminating the need to relay vast amounts of information to the cloud. This is essential for applications requiring immediate response times, such as self-driving cars or medical treatment. Secondly, Edge AI enhances data privacy and security by keeping sensitive information localized on the device.

Finally, Edge AI empowers a wide range for applications by enabling offline operation, opening up opportunities in remote or resource-constrained environments.
